Can You Guess Who This Little Boy Became Later in Life?

A childhood photograph can be misleading. The boy appears calm, but his surroundings valued discipline, competition, and achievement. From early on, he learned that “strength was praised while vulnerability was quietly discouraged,” and that life was something to be mastered through visibility and control.

Approval came through performance. Confidence was not optional; it was expected. In this environment, “confidence was treated as a necessity rather than a trait,” shaping the belief that winning mattered more than reflection or self-doubt.

Strict expectations reinforced these ideas. Success brought value, while failure drew judgment. Emotional space was narrow, and affection often came with conditions. Even when illness revealed fragility, “lingering on weakness was never encouraged,” teaching that security came from appearing strong.

As adolescence added more structure, discipline and hierarchy hardened these lessons. Order and authority mattered, achievement earned recognition, and identity became tied to rank. Over time, “projecting certainty became second nature,” while retreat or hesitation felt unacceptable.

Years later, these early patterns reappeared on a public stage. In business and media, image merged with success, and confidence defined leadership. Donald J. Trump carried forward the same core lessons: that strength must be visible, winning must be claimed, and control often feels safer than reflection.
